I got a Keeley Compressor Mini recently as I've started playing more percussive rhythm guitar and felt that I needed a bit of compression just to tighten everything up. I now leave it on all the time, set fairly low and it has a fair bit of clean signal blended in to make it sound natural.
I went to a guitar shop a couple of days ago and picked up a J Mascis Telecaster. While I was trying it out plugged straight into a Blackstar combo thing I realised how much I now lean on the compressor without even realising it!
Beware the compressor!

Dynacomps are an old design, with no clean blend, so they're notoriously squishy and only really good for country chicken pickin (or so I'm lead to believe!)
